Fungus: Dutch Folk Go Dutch
Fred Dellar, NME, 27 December 1975
THERE WAS A time when the Dutch folk scene just mirror-imaged that of Britain. For every traddie rendering 'Lord Randall' or 'Twa Corbies' at Loughborough or some other English folk fest, there was a clog-footed equivalent doing exactly the same thing, using exactly the same voice and using the same inflections, in a folk club in Amsterdam or Utrecht.
